So, let’s break this down. If you were to qualify for groove welds in the overhead position, you’d need to know that this skill doesn’t just stop there. In fact, it opens up a world of possibilities, allowing you to take on the flat and vertical positions as well. Why? Let’s dig into that.

Overhead: The Pinnacle of Precision

The overhead position is like the Mount Everest of welding—you’re not just battling gravity; you’re mastering it. When you're welding overhead, the molten pool of metal tends to drip and fall, making control not just beneficial but essential. This position demands a high level of skill and technique, setting a benchmark for the welder's proficiency.

Now, think about it: if you can handle welding upside down—working against the natural pull of gravity, controlling that tricky weld pool—you’re likely to be more than equipped to manage other positions. In a way, excelling in overhead welding shows you’re more than ready for the challenges of both flat and vertical positions.

Flat Position: Taking a Load Off

Welding in the flat position is often seen as the easier of the three. Why? Well, gravity works in your favor. The weld pool is more stable, which generally allows for cleaner, more controlled welds. This position is usually the first stop for welders, as it helps build foundational skills that can later be translated into more difficult positions. If you can master your overhead skills, the flat position is nearly a walk in the park.
